Ingredients
This delicious and nutrient-dense bowl is packed with roasted chicken, sweet potatoes, massaged kale, brown rice, creamy chipotle sauce, crumbled feta, and fresh avocado. It’s a satisfying and flavorful meal that’s perfect for a healthy lunch or dinner!
For the Roasted Chicken and Sweet Potatoes:
- 2 tablespoons avocado oil
- 1 medium sweet potato, peeled and cut into 1/2 pieces
- 8 oz chicken breast, cut into bite-sized pieces
For the Homemade Seasoning Blend:
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t (or 1/4 teaspoon sea salt)
- 1/2 teaspoon chili powder
- 1/4 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
- 1/8 teaspoon ground cinnamon
For the Kale:
- 2 packed cups kale leaves
- 2 teaspoons olive oil
- 1 teaspoon fresh lemon juice (or lime juice)
- Pinch of salt
For the Creamy Chipotle Sauce:
- 1/4 cup plain Greek yogurt
- 2 tablespoons mayonnaise (like Duke’s or Hellmann’s)
- 1 tablespoon chipotle sauce (or 1 teaspoon finely chopped chipotle in adobo)
- 1 teaspoon fresh lemon juice (or lime juice)
- 1/2 teaspoon agave syrup (or honey)
- 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t, (or 1/4 teaspoon sea salt), plus more to taste
For the Bowl/Toppings:
- 2 cups cooked brown rice(or white rice)
- 1/4 cup crumbled feta cheese
- 1 medium avocado, sliced or diced
- Chopped green onions, for garnish (optional)

How to Make Roasted Chicken, Sweet Potato, and Kale Bowls
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at the oven to 400°F.
Step 2: Season and Roast the Sweet Potatoes
- Mix all the seasoning blend ingredients in a small bowl.
- Toss the diced sweet potatoes with 1 tablespoon avocado oil and half of the seasoning blend in a large mixing bowl.
- Spread the seasoned sweet potatoes onto a rimmed baking sheet, ensuring some space between pieces.
- Roast for 10 minutes.
Step 3: Season and Roast the Chicken
While the sweet potatoes roast:
1. Toss the chicken pieces in the same mixing bowl with the remaining 1 tablespoon avocado oil and seasoning blend.
2. After 10 minutes, remove the sweet potatoes from the oven, toss them gently, and nestle seasoned chicken pieces onto the same baking sheet.
3. Return to the oven and bake for another 15 minutes until sweet potatoes are tender and ch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F.
Step 4: Massage the Kale
While roasting:
1. Place kale leaves in a bowl.
2. Drizzle with olive oil, lemon juice, and a pinch of salt.
3. Massage kale for about 1 minute until tender. Set aside.
Step 5: Make the Chipotle Sauce
In a small bowl:
1. Combine Greek yogurt, mayonnaise, chipotle sauce, lemon juice, agave syrup, and a pinch of salt.
2. Mix until smooth; adjust salt to taste.
Step 6: Assemble the Bowls
Divide cooked rice between two bowls; top each with massaged kale, roasted sweet potatoes, chicken pieces:
– Add sliced avocado,
– Crumbled feta cheese,
– And chopped green onions if desired.
– Drizzle creamy chipotle sauce over top before serving immediately!

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Even the best recipes can go wrong if you’re not careful. Here are some common mistakes to watch for when making Roasted Chicken, Sweet Potato, and Kale Bowls.
- Overcrowding the Baking Sheet: When you place sweet potatoes and chicken too close together, they steam instead of roast. Make sure to leave space between pieces for even cooking.
- Skipping the Seasoning: Not seasoning the chicken and sweet potatoes can lead to bland flavors. Use all the spices in the seasoning blend for maximum taste.
- Under-massaging the Kale: If you don’t massage the kale enough, it can remain tough and bitter. Spend at least a minute massaging it with oil and salt to enhance its flavor and texture.
- Using Cold Ingredients: Starting with cold chicken or sweet potatoes can result in uneven cooking. Let them sit at room temperature for about 15 minutes before roasting.
- Not Adjusting Sauce Spice Level: If you’re unsure about spice levels, you may overdo the chipotle sauce. Start with a smaller amount and adjust to your taste as you mix.
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store in airtight containers for up to 3 days.
- Allow food to cool completely before sealing to prevent moisture buildup.
Freezing Roasted Chicken, Sweet Potato, and Kale Bowls
- Freeze individual portions in freezer-safe containers for up to 2 months.
- Label each container with the date for easy tracking.
Reheating Roasted Chicken, Sweet Potato, and Kale Bowls
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F and heat for about 15-20 minutes until warmed through.
- Microwave: Place in a microwave-safe dish and heat for 2-3 minutes, stirring halfway through.
- Stovetop: Heat on medium-low in a skillet, stirring occasionally until warmed through.
